BLACKPINK’s Lisa opens up about stalker fans: “I was scared to be alone”

Reading now: 274

BLACKPINK‘s Lisa has recently opened up about her encounter with stalker fans, calling the experience “terrifying”.BLACKPINK’s Lisa recently appeared on the Thai radio talk show WOODY FM, where she opened up about her experiences with stalker fans. “I’ve never shared this before.

Last year, it was the first time I actually experienced it myself,” she said. “I’ve heard a lot about it from other idol friends, mostly from male idols.

But it just happened to me.”“Usually, when my flight lands in South Korea, fans will be there waiting at the airport. That’s normal, and I appreciate that they come.

But when I got home, I saw them waiting,” she recalled. The singer also added how she was “alone” at her house and how the walls around her home “aren’t that high”.“So I told that person, ‘I’m really not comfortable with this.
